Southwest Hearing Aid Center, Worthington, MN, has a new name: Southwest Hearing Technologies Incorporated. Glad Henning, NBC-HIS Certified Hearing Aid Specialist, began celebrating her retirement on January 1st, 2014. Henning’s nephew-in-law, Nicholas Raymo, Certified Hearing Instrument Dispenser, and the staff of Southwest Hearing Technologies Incorporated, will continue to provide the latest in hearing technology services and products.
“I would not have had this opportunity to work with hearing issues if it hadn’t been for Glad. She got me interested and as I worked with our customers, I realized how much I enjoy working in the industry,” Raymo stated.
Services provided by Southwest Hearing Technologies Incorporated include the latest in hearing technology, sales and service, repairs and batteries. They are also offering a new line of hearing protection products.
“We will be able to provide hearing protection for industrial workers and hunters and others who are in need of those products,” Raymo stated. “There are so many great products that can help with hearing problems, and there are great products to provide hearing protection. Our staff can help our customers find what works best for them.” Southwest Hearing Technologies staff care about what their customers hear, and have recently purchased a new audiometer. Staff can test to find out what a client is hearing and what they are missing out on hearing. They will recommend the correct devices to help improve the quality of hearing.
